Role overview

Reporting to the Group Company Secretary, we are seeking a Director of Governance - UK Bank to lead a dedicated team responsible for the effective operation of the Starling Bank Limited board and executive risk committee framework. This role ensures compliance with PRA and FCA requirements and promotes high standards of corporate governance. You will be passionate about corporate governance, continuously seeking improvement, and thrive in a dynamic and fast-paced environment. This is a senior position working closely with board members and senior leadership. You will lead by example and demonstrate an unwavering commitment to excellence. As a skilled communicator, you will play a critical role in shaping and executing the Bank’s corporate governance strategy, also supporting the broader Group Company Secretariat strategy. Strong regulated financial services and/or banking experience is essential.

Key Responsibilities

  • Leading and developing a high-performance corporate governance team of four, with one direct report (Senior Assistant Company Secretary - UK Bank).
  • Working with the Group Company Secretary and Deputy Company Secretary to provide high-quality company secretariat support to the Starling Bank Board.
  • Leading company secretariat support for the Starling Bank Board Risk Committee, preparing agendas, collating, reviewing and distributing papers, preparing high-quality minutes, and maintaining timely information flows with senior management.
  • Supporting annual effectiveness reviews of board and executive level risk committees, ensuring continuous improvement in governance standards.
  • Monitoring and advising on corporate governance trends, emerging regulatory developments and industry best practice.
  • Contributing to the production of the Group Annual Report and Accounts from a Bank perspective.

Qualifications

  • A qualified chartered secretary (ACG, FCG or equivalent) with proven senior level governance experience.
  • Minimum 5 years’ experience in regulated financial services.
  • UK banking experience is preferred but not essential.

Experience

  • Deep knowledge of UK corporate governance standards, company law and UK regulatory frameworks (FCA, PRA, SMCR etc).
  • Proven track record of engaging with board members and senior executives in a strategic governance role, designing and refining corporate governance processes, and maintaining their alignment to strategy and business operating models.
  • Strong leadership skills with experience in building and managing governance teams.
  • Excellent minute-taking skills with the ability to write clear, accurate and concise minutes in short order, balancing different stakeholder perspectives.
  • Exceptional communication, influencing, and stakeholder management skills with the ability to operate at the highest levels of an organisation.
  • Proven ability to work in a fast paced or high growth environment.
